#372796 Color
#372796 is rgb(55, 39, 150) in RGB, hsl(249, 59%, 37%) in HSL, and about cmyk(63%, 74%, 0%, 41%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Blue (Pigment) (#333399),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.86.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#372796 Channel Values
How #372796 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 55 · G 39 · B 150 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 249° · S 59% · L 37%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 249° · S 74% · V 59%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 63% · M 74% · Y 0% · K 41%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 11.09:1 vs white · 1.89: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#372796 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#372796 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#372796?
#372796 is a dark blue — rgb(55, 39, 150) in RGB and hsl(249, 59%, 37%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Blue (Pigment) (#333399),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.86.
What is the RGB value of #372796?
#372796 is rgb(55, 39, 150) — red 55, green 39, and blue 150 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#372796?
#372796 converts to approximately cmyk(63%, 74%, 0%, 41%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#372796 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#372796 scores 11.09:1 against white and 1.89: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#372796 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#372796 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is midnightblue (#191970) at a CIE76 distance of 14.73, which is visibly different.
